#acb6d6 color RGB value is (172,182,214). #acb6d6 color name is Custom Color color.

#acb6d6 hex color red value is 172, green value is 182 and the blue value of its RGB is 214.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#acb6d6 hue: 0.63, saturation: 0.34 and the lightness value of acb6d6 is 0.76.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#acb6d6 color hex is 0.20, 0.15, 0.00, 0.16. Web safe color of #acb6d6 is #99cccc. Color #acb6d6 contains mainly BLUE color.

About #ACB6D6 Custom Color

#ACB6D6 (Custom Color) is a blue-based color with RGB values of 172, 182, 214. This color belongs to the blue color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#acb6d6,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#acb6d6 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#acb6d6), RGB (rgb(172, 182, 214)), HSL (hsl(226, 34%, 76%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#99cccc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
